Voice Search
Voice search continues to grow rapidly, changing how users conduct online inquiries. With around 55% of households projected to own a smart speaker by 2025, optimizing for voice search is essential. Voice search queries often differ from text queries; they tend to be longer and more conversational. By adopting natural language processing techniques, you can enhance your content to align with how people speak. As a result, targeting long-tail keywords and focusing on local search optimization allows your business to engage effectively with voice-activated devices. What are Core Web Vitals?
Core Web Vitals are key performance metrics introduced by Google to measure user experience on websites. They focus on aspects such as page load time, interactivity, and visual stability, influencing how sites rank in search results.

How do voice search trends affect SEO?
Voice search trends are changing SEO practices by necessitating optimization for longer, conversational queries. With the growing use of voice-activated devices, businesses must adapt their content strategies to include natural language that aligns with voice search behaviors.
